High Risk of Death or Disability in Brain Hemorrhage: Role of Spot Sign and Secondary Markers

- 主要终点
- Hematoma Expansion within 48 Hours: Increase of more than 6 mL or over 30% between the initial CT and the follow-up CT (PREDICT study criterion) and/or Occurrence of Death Within the First Month
研究概览
简要总结
This study looks at patients with brain hemorrhage to see if a special sign on brain scans, called the "Spot Sign," combined with other scan features, can predict a higher risk of death or disability. By comparing patient outcomes with existing prediction scores, the study aims to understand whether these scan markers provide extra value in identifying patients at higher risk.

入选标准
- •Spontaneous intracerebral hemorrhage confirmed by contrast-enhanced CT scan.
- •Follow-up CT scan performed within 24 to 48 hours.
- •Non-inclusion Criteria :
- •Absence of initial contrast-enhanced CT or follow-up CT.
- •Hematoma due to trauma, epidural hematoma (EDH), subdural hematoma (SDH), or subarachnoid hemorrhage (SAH).
排除标准
- •Patient deceased before the initial contrast-enhanced CT.
- •Major missing clinical data.
结局指标
主要结局
Hematoma Expansion within 48 Hours: Increase of more than 6 mL or over 30% between the initial CT and the follow-up CT (PREDICT study criterion) and/or Occurrence of Death Within the First Month
时间窗: 48 hours
